  • In this paper, the progresses and trends in some active topics for shock-induced phase transition research are reviewed, such as phase transition plasticity, shear stress effects, post-phase-transition behavior, theory and constitutive description for shock-induced phase transitions, and instantaneous and real-time measurements for microscopic mechanisms. The importance for direct measurement of transverse shear behavior of materials under shock loading is emphasized.
